Now that the "cover connections" thread seems to have dried up for a while, maybe it might be time for another thread feat. cover pics?

What got me thinking of this was reading a bit about The Mekons, and being confused about the title of their debut album: "the quality of mercy is not strnen". I tried to look for different ways of reading, for crap puns etc, but all I could come up with was that it was a corruption of Shakespeare's line "The quality of mercy is not strained", from The Merchant of Venice. But what was the point of writing "strnen" instead of "strained"? AMG gave me the answer...

Re: the Mekons cover....
You must of heard of the idea, you know the one that says that if you get an infinite number of monkeys and put them in front of an infinite number of typewriters for an infinite amount of time, at some point one of them will write the works of Shakespeare. The monkey on the Mekons cover is one of the infinite number.
